The famously savory, sloppy stew is is traditionally made with beef or goat meat and is enjoyed alone with a spoon or stuffed into tacos, quesadillas, or mulitas (a sort of double-decker quesadilla), ideally with a side of consomm\u00e9 for dipping.<\/p>\n<p>Fueled by <a href=\"https:\/\/buradabiliyorum.com\/en\/category\/social-mediaa\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"1\" title=\"Social Media\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">social media<\/a>\u2014on TikTok, <a r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/www.tiktok.com\/tag\/birria?lang=en\">#Birria <\/a>currently has over 850 million views, with videos showing people munching and dunking tacos, then exclaiming how tasty they are\u2014the Mexican dish has taken the city by storm.  New restaurants and food trucks are popping up around the boroughs to satisfy a growing hunger for it.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cBirria is trending,\u201d 17-year-old Brandon Sanchez told The Post, explaining how he ended up at the Birria-Landia food truck in Jackson Heights. Sanchez, who lives in Queens, said his first bite lived up to the hype: his birria taco had \u201cthe right amount of spice to it \u2014 not too spicy but you get that tanginess of flavor.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>His friend, Zayda Hernandez, also 17, added: \u201cMexican food is already popular in itself, so with birria, more and more [restaurants] are going to pop up.\u201d <\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" width=\"1024\" height=\"682\" alt=\"Zayda Hernandez, 17, left, and Brandon Sanchez, 17, right, eat at Birria-Landia.\" class=\"wp-image-19023252 lazyload\" srcset=\"https:\/\/nypost.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2021\/08\/birria-tacos-birria-landia-5.jpg?quality=90&amp;strip=all&amp;w=300 300w, https:\/\/nypost.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2021\/08\/birria-tacos-birria-landia-5.jpg?quality=90&amp;strip=all&amp;w=640 640w, https:\/\/nypost.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2021\/08\/birria-tacos-birria-landia-5.jpg?quality=90&amp;strip=all&amp;w=1280 1280w, https:\/\/nypost.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2021\/08\/birria-tacos-birria-landia-5.jpg?quality=90&amp;strip=all&amp;w=1024 1024w, https:\/\/nypost.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2021\/08\/birria-tacos-birria-landia-5.jpg?quality=90&amp;strip=all&amp;w=2000 2000w\" data-sizes=\"(max-width: 640px) 100vw, 1024px\"\/><figcaption>Zayda Hernandez, 17, left, and Brandon Sanchez, 17, right, eat at Birria-Landia.<\/figcaption><figcaption><span class=\"credit\">Stephen Yang<\/span><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>Jos\u00e9 Moreno, a native of Puebla, Mexico, co-founded Birria-Landia with his\u00a0brother Jes\u00fas\u00a0in the summer of 2019. He notes that birria is typically seasoned with chili peppers, garlic and bay leaves, and served with onion, cilantro and lime. <\/p>\n<p>He said the birria boom has obviously been a boon for his business, especially since it\u2019s the only meat on the menu.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If you sell birria, you don\u2019t have to sell carnitas or other meats. A third location may be in the works.<\/p>\n<p><em>5:30 p.m. to 1 a.m. 77-99 Roosevelt Ave., Jackson Heights, Queens; 347-283-2162, <a r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/qrusamenu.com\/birrialandia\/\">QRUSAMenu.com\/BirriaLandia<\/a><\/em><\/p>\n<p><em>Monday-Friday 5 p.m. to 1 a.m., Saturday-Sunday 2 p.m. to 12 a.m. Metropolitan and Meeker Aves., Williamsburg; 347-839-8706<\/em><\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Las_Delicias_Mexicanas\"><\/span>Las Delicias Mexicanas<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><!--If the slideshow is embedded in another post type add the inline wrapper --><\/p>\n<p><strong>The wait: <\/strong>Usually you can just walk right in, although it picks up on weekends for dinner.<\/p>\n<p><strong>What to order:<\/strong> Their birria ($15.95) is prepared with spicy goat meat and vegetables in a broth made with guajillo chilies; it\u2019s served as a stew with a side of tortillas. Their pozole ($15.95), a Mexican soup made with hominy, pork and oregano, is also worth trying.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s a standout: <\/strong>Carrots lend a nice sweet note to the spicy broth, and the use of goat, not beef, makes it a more traditional option amongst some of the newer places offering the dish with other proteins. <\/p>\n<p><em>Every day 11 a.m. to 8 p.m. 2109 3rd Ave.; 212-828-3659<\/em><\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Chinelos_Birria_Tacos\"><\/span>Chinelos Birria Tacos<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><!--If the slideshow is embedded in another post type add the inline wrapper --><\/p>\n<p><strong>The wait: <\/strong>Peak hours for the food truck are from 7 to 8 p.m., but the wait is usually no more than 10 minutes.<\/p>\n<p><strong>What to order:<\/strong> Birria tacos (three for $10, $14 if paired with consomm\u00e9), tortas ($9) and or quesadillas ($10).<\/p>\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s a standout:<\/strong> The well-seasoned meat is perfectly complemented by a cool, homemade salsa. Plus, Chinelos parks in Hunter\u2019s Point, near Gantry State Park, making for spectacular views as you chow down. <\/p>\n<p><em>Hours vary. 4-09 Center Blvd., Long Island City, Queens; 917-819-9066, <a r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\" href=\"http:\/\/orderchinelostacosnyc.com\/\">O<\/a><a r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/www.instagram.com\/chinelostacosnyc\/?hl=en\">rderChinelosTacosNYC.com<\/a><\/em><\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Tacos_Guey\"><\/span>Tacos G\u00fcey<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><!--If the slideshow is embedded in another post type add the inline wrapper --><\/p>\n<p><strong>The wait: <\/strong>You can walk right in at most times, although Saturday nights are often crowded.<\/p>\n<p><strong>What to order: <\/strong>Their birria tacos (two for $17) are prepared with lamb and salsa negra. They pair well with a sea bass ceviche ($19) with chile oil and gooseberries or with a side of plantains ($9) or curtidos (cabbage salsa, $7).<\/p>\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s a standout: <\/strong>Chef Henry Zamora, an alum of the French Laundry, offers an upscale take on the trend, with mouthwatering chile-braised lamb birria with paper-thin tortillas.
